Crawl Space Remediation in Littleton, CO
Crawl space remediation services focus on addressing issues beneath a property’s foundation that can impact the overall health and safety of a home. These projects typically involve identifying and eliminating problems such as moisture intrusion, mold growth, pest infestations, and structural damage. Homeowners often seek this service to improve indoor air quality, prevent wood rot, and reduce energy costs caused by inefficient insulation or ventilation. Before requesting crawl space remediation,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the damage, the causes of moisture or pests, and the recommended solutions to ensure a dry, clean, and stable foundation.
This service covers a variety of projects, including moisture barrier installation, mold removal, pest eradication, and structural repairs. Homeowners should consider whether their crawl space has visible signs of water intrusion, musty odors, or pest activity, as these are common indicators that remediation may be needed. Understanding the specific issues within the crawl space helps determine the appropriate scope of work and ensures that the foundation remains secure and free from ongoing problems. Proper remediation can contribute to a healthier living environment and help maintain the property's value over time.

Common Crawl Space Remediation Jobs
Mold and Mildew Removal - eliminates mold growth caused by excess moisture in the crawl space.
Water Damage Restoration - addresses leaks and flooding that compromise structural integrity.
Insulation Repair and Replacement - improves energy efficiency and prevents pest entry.
Vapor Barrier Installation - reduces moisture levels and prevents mold development.
Pest Prevention Services - removes and blocks pests that can damage the crawl space.
Structural Drying and Ventilation - restores proper airflow to prevent future moisture problems.
Crawl Space Remediation Questions
What is crawl space remediation? It involves identifying and fixing issues like moisture, mold, or pests in a crawl space to improve home health and safety.
Why is crawl space remediation important? Addressing problems in the crawl space helps prevent structural damage, reduces indoor humidity, and improves air quality.
What types of problems are addressed during remediation? Common issues include mold growth, water intrusion, pest infestations, and wood rot.
How can homeowners tell if crawl space remediation is needed? Signs include musty odors, visible mold, excessive humidity, or pest activity in the home’s lower levels.
